NZ's first European settlement and seaport so full of...
NZ's first European settlement and seaport so full of history and beautifully kept old buildings including a church still with bullet holes from times gone by. Lots of lovely bays (Helena, Teal, Oakura, Tapeka) and beaches within easy travelling distance but the closest with great swiming is Long Bay beach a few minutes over the hill from Russell. Great coffee can be had there too! If you want to do day trips, take your car on the car ferry at Okiato to Opua and head north to Paihia, Waitangi, and Kerikeri - all close by. Further north there is Mangonui, Cable Bay and Doubtless bay all overlooking the water and rather beautiful as is all the area. Russell has some great restaurants, cafes, supermarket for food and the usual tourist type shops plus you can catch the passenger ferry to Paihia for a few hours to check out their cafes too. We stayed 4 days and having our own car, found plenty to do while out exploring and sight seeing.Guest review byIbhappiNew Zealand - 4.0

Taipa has the lovely resort and beach, but there is not much...
Taipa has the lovely resort and beach, but there is not much else. However, Taipa is part of a gorgeous stretch of coastline including Cable Bay, Coopers beach and Mangonui. Within a few kilometers you have all the amenities you need, plus local attractions and shopping. There is the Famous Mangonui Fish shop over the water, a couple more lovely cafes, places to buy local art and craft, a walkway and pa, a picaresque harbour and opportunities to get out on the water.
